The Orvane Labs bike cage and the east and west parking gates operate on separate access schedules, and facilities desk staff should note that visitor vehicles may only use the west gate between 07:00 and 19:00. Cyclists requesting cage access must show a valid day pass, and their details should be entered in the access ledger before the cage is opened. Gates must never be propped open, even briefly, during deliveries. When a manual override is required at either gate, use the code below.

staff pass of fadup-fawig = bdg-FUNKS-4

Runbook: Scanline barcode bridge

If warehouse scans stop flowing into Cartwheel, it's almost always the bridge service on the Dunmore floor box wedging after a USB hiccup. Bounce the service first — nine times out of ten that fixes it. If not, check the queue depth before escalating. When restarting, make sure the bridge comes up with these settings.

deployment values, yafop-bajef:
[gilok]
team = ulaius
access_code = ac_423664
host = gilok.sivrelhq.corp
port = 9200
owner = pelius.istax
peer = eliok.torvasoft.internal

## Ownership

Rounding behavior in the Minthaven currency conversion module is intentionally centralized. All conversions must route through `convert()` so banker's rounding is applied once, at the final step — never round intermediate values in your plugin, or cumulative drift will reappear in multi-hop conversions. Bug reports about off-by-one-cent totals should include the full conversion chain. Questions, patches, and rounding-policy exceptions are handled by the module owner named below.

account owner for bawip-tahag: Raleth Quenok